What is a Crypto Casino?
A Crypto Casino (https://hub.docker.com/U/betstrikee) is an online gambling platform that enables users to deposit, wager, and withdraw funds using different c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and Tether (GBPT).
Unlike traditional online casinos that rely on banking institutions, charge card, or e-wallets, crypto casinos run primarily on blockchain innovation. This core difference removes the "intermediary," typically resulting in much faster transaction times and lower charges. Many modern-day crypto casinos also utilize "Provably Fair" technology, which enables players to verify the randomness and fairness of every video game outcome by means of cryptographic hashes.

Necessary Safety List for Crypto Gamblers
- Never ever share your personal secrets: A genuine casino will never request your wallet seed expression.
- Use a devoted wallet: Do not send out funds straight from an exchange (like Coinbase or Kraken) to a casino. Use a personal, non-custodial wallet (like MetaMask or Ledger) as an intermediary.
- Enable 2FA: Always enable Google Authenticator or similar security apps on your casino account.
- Start little: Before transferring a large amount to protect a VIP benefit, deposit a percentage to evaluate their withdrawal speed.
- Practice accountable gaming: Treat gaming as home entertainment, not an income. Set strict deposit limits.

Q: Are crypto casinos legal?A: Legality depends upon your jurisdiction. While some countries explicitly enable crypto gambling, others have stringent policies. Always check your regional laws before playing.
Q: Can I lose money if the cost of Bitcoin drops?A: Yes. If you deposit BTC and it drops in value while in your account, your balance will reflect that. This is why many gamers prefer utilizing stablecoins like Tether (GBPT).
Q: Do I require to be tech-savvy to use a crypto casino?A: Not at all. Establishing a digital wallet and sending funds is really similar to using apps like PayPal or Venmo. When you have funds in a wallet, depositing is as simple as scanning a QR code on the casino's deposit page.
Q: Is "Provably Fair" really reasonable?A: Yes. It utilizes cryptographic algorithms that ensure the casino can not control the outcome of a game once it has begun. You can confirm the result after every round versus the "seed" provided by the casino.
